Neither FitGPT nor Stryde Workout Planner offers a free trial.
Pricing details for both FitGPT and Stryde Workout Planner are unavailable at this time. Contact the respective providers for more information.
Stryde Workout Planner offers several advantages, including Custom workout planning, Rest period customization, Superset inclusion, Variety of exercises, Performance tracking and analysis and many more functionalities.
The cons of Stryde Workout Planner may include a Only for iOS devices, Requires iOS 12.4 or later, No data collection (No personalized suggestions based on data), In-app purchases required for single workouts. and Lacks variety in exercises
